Kuraray America appoints new president and CEO

LinkedIn +

Liquid rubber producer Kuraray America Inc. (KAI) has appointed Hitoshi Toyoura as its new president and CEO.

Kuraray also develops performance-based polymer and synthetic chemistry technologies, including resins, chemical, fibers, and textiles, with research and production facilities in Houston, Texas.

Toyoura joins KAI from Kuraray’s Osaka, Japan, office where he served as a director and senior executive officer. During his 35-year tenure with the company, he has worked for the fiber sector and has held numerous leadership positions.

An experienced international business leader, Toyoura spent more than 20 years of his early career in the business of paper and non-woven fabrics, followed by four years in the business of filament, spinning yarn and fiber reinforcement.

After the retirement of George Avdey, who served as the company’s president for five years of his 18-year tenure, Toyoura assumed the role of president.

“Together with a dedicated team, I look forward to continuing the momentum of Kuraray America’s growth within the specialty chemical industry,” said Toyoura.

“I’m confident my history with the company will bring a unique perspective to the KAI team, while we continue our commitment to safety, our customer’s needs, and our community.”
